Transaction e4f3cd496b2beb32e3bb224ddc6fd4905289da140c8f95b1fb083f2090323236

2 Input
2 Outputs
  • e4f3cd496b2beb32e3bb224ddc6fd4905289da140c8f95b1fb083f2090323236:0
  • value  583950083
    address  32efrk4LAyUgW9cd1yvZ75VpBPR4n9gtyr
  • e4f3cd496b2beb32e3bb224ddc6fd4905289da140c8f95b1fb083f2090323236:1
  • value  1999900000
    address  3JDnYpB14SyjGXbQWMdRw7vAiW9hToHZ4t